Patricia King


SHERRILL – Patricia Male King, Park Terrace, passed away on Saturday, Sept. 16, 2006, in the Oneida Healthcare Center, where she had been a medical patient for the past three days.
Born in Deposit, on May 27, 1921, she was the daughter of Barna and Madlyn Detrick Male. A resident of Sherrill for the past forty-seven years, Patricia was a graduate of Norwich High School, Class of 1938. She married James F. King, Sr. in Norwich on Aug. 7, 1943. James passed away on Sept. 10, 1997.
Prior to her retirement in 1986, Patricia was employed with Marshall and Houseman, Inc., formerly of Sherrill as an accountant and previously had been employed with John A. Shannon, Accountant and the Ration Board of Chenango County. She was member of the Verona Presbyterian Church, a former member of Zonta International, was active with Verona Elementary Parent-Teachers Association and was a life member and past president of Oneida Elks #767 Auxiliary for the past forty-three years.
Patricia maintained dual memberships in the Order of the Eastern Star, Silver Star Chapter #21 where she served as the current secretary since 1972 and was a Past Matron, serving in 1964 and 1969 and the Order of the Eastern Star, Norwich Chapter #367 for the past sixty-two years and was a Past Matron, having served in 1958. She also served as a District Deputy Grand Matron of the Cortland-Madison District in 1968.
Surviving is one daughter and son-in-law, Gayle and Richard Bouchard of Dale City, Va.; two sons, James F. King, Jr. and his companion, Pamela Folmar of Corning and Brian M. King of Sherrill; five grandchildren, Stephen King and Michael King and Michelle Bouchard, Suzanne Bouchard and Elliot Bouchard; one great-grandchild, Madlyn Bouchard.
She was predeceased by a brother Barna Male, Jr. in 2001.
